Vasopressin, MSEL-neurophysin and copeptin have been isolated from guinea pig and rat neurophypophyses and their amino acid sequences have been determined. Whereas in rat processing of the three-domain precursor is complete, in the guinea pig a 132-residue fragment including MSEL-neurophysin and copeptin linked by an arginine residue has been characterized. This incomplete maturation (20% of the precursor) could be due to a deletion of an acidic residue in guinea pig copeptin when compared with other mammalian copeptins.
